CVE-2019-10359: Cross-Site Request Forgery (CSRF)

May 24, 2022 (updated February 2, 2023)

A cross-site request forgery vulnerability in Jenkins Maven Release Plugin 0.14.0 and earlier in the M2ReleaseAction#doSubmit method allowed attackers to perform releases with attacker-specified options.

Affected versions

All versions before 0.15.0

Fixed versions

  • 0.15.0

Solution

Upgrade to version 0.15.0 or above.
